Understanding Silicone Render Technology
Silicone render represents a significant advancement in external wall coating technology, utilising silicone resins as the primary binder rather than traditional cement or lime. This fundamental difference creates a render with unique properties that make it particularly suitable for challenging environments like those found around Swansea. The silicone polymers provide exceptional flexibility, allowing the render to accommodate building movement without cracking. This flexibility proves crucial in coastal areas where temperature variations and wind loading can stress rigid render systems. The material also exhibits excellent water repellency while maintaining breathability, creating an ideal balance for building protection. When properly applied, silicone render forms a protective barrier that prevents water ingress while allowing moisture vapour to escape from the building structure.

Key Performance Characteristics
Modern silicone render systems demonstrate remarkable performance characteristics that address the specific challenges faced by Swansea properties. The material’s inherent flexibility allows it to accommodate thermal movement and minor structural settlement without developing cracks. This flexibility remains consistent across a wide temperature range, maintaining performance through the seasonal variations experienced in South Wales. The water-repellent properties of silicone render provide excellent protection against driving rain, which can be particularly severe in coastal locations. Despite this water resistance, the material maintains breathability, allowing moisture vapour to pass through and preventing the buildup of condensation within wall structures.
Self-cleaning properties represent another significant advantage of quality silicone render systems. The smooth surface and chemical composition naturally shed dirt and organic growth, helping maintain the appearance over time with minimal maintenance. This characteristic proves particularly valuable in urban environments where pollution and coastal locations where salt deposits can affect building appearance. The colour stability of silicone render surpasses that of many alternatives, with high-quality systems maintaining their appearance for many years without fading or discolouration. This durability ensures that the investment in silicone render continues to provide aesthetic and protective benefits throughout its service life.

Coastal Weather Protection
Swansea’s position on the Bristol Channel creates weather conditions that demand robust external finishes. The prevailing westerly winds bring moisture-laden air that can drive rain horizontally against building facades, testing the performance of any external coating. Silicone render’s water-repellent properties provide excellent protection against this driving rain, preventing water penetration that could lead to internal damp problems. The material’s flexibility allows it to withstand the thermal cycling that occurs as buildings warm in sunshine and cool in coastal breezes, maintaining its protective integrity through these constant changes.
Salt corrosion presents a particular challenge for buildings near the Swansea seafront and throughout Gower. Traditional renders can suffer from salt crystallisation, where salt deposits within the render expand and contract with humidity changes, causing surface deterioration and spalling. Silicone render’s chemical resistance and water-repellent properties minimise salt penetration, reducing this form of deterioration. The self-cleaning characteristics also help remove salt deposits from the surface, maintaining both appearance and performance over time.
Application Process and Techniques
Professional application of silicone render requires careful preparation and skilled technique to achieve optimal results. The process begins with thorough assessment of the existing substrate, ensuring it provides a suitable base for the new render system. Any defects, loose material, or contamination must be addressed before application begins. Proper preparation often includes cleaning, repair work, and the application of appropriate primers or bonding agents to ensure adhesion. The substrate must be sound, stable, and free from moisture that could affect the render’s performance.
Spray application of silicone render demands specialised equipment and expertise to achieve consistent results. Professional spray systems must be properly calibrated to deliver the correct material flow rate and pressure for the specific product being applied. Environmental conditions play a crucial role in successful application, with temperature, humidity, and wind conditions all affecting the process. Experienced applicators understand how to adjust techniques for varying conditions and can identify when conditions are unsuitable for application. The spray technique itself requires skill to maintain consistent thickness and achieve uniform coverage, particularly around architectural details and junction points.
Quality control during application ensures that the finished silicone render Swansea installation meets performance expectations. This includes monitoring thickness to ensure adequate coverage, checking for uniform appearance, and verifying that all areas receive proper protection. Professional contractors maintain detailed records of application conditions and procedures, providing documentation that supports warranty coverage. The curing process must be protected from adverse weather conditions, with appropriate measures taken to prevent rain damage or contamination during the initial cure period.
Substrate Preparation Requirements
Successful silicone render application depends heavily on proper substrate preparation, which varies depending on the existing surface condition and type. Masonry substrates require assessment for soundness, with any loose or damaged material removed and repaired. Surface contamination from previous coatings, biological growth, or pollution must be thoroughly cleaned to ensure proper adhesion. The substrate moisture content must be within acceptable limits, as excessive moisture can prevent proper bonding and affect the render’s performance.
Existing render surfaces present particular challenges that require careful evaluation. Sound, well-adhered render can often serve as a suitable substrate after appropriate preparation, while failing or hollow render must be removed. The compatibility between existing materials and new silicone render systems must be considered to prevent chemical reactions or adhesion problems. Professional assessment can identify potential issues and recommend appropriate preparation procedures to ensure successful application.

Maintenance and Longevity Considerations
One of the primary advantages of silicone render systems is their minimal maintenance requirements compared to traditional alternatives. The self-cleaning properties of quality silicone renders help maintain appearance with natural weathering, reducing the need for regular cleaning or maintenance interventions. However, understanding proper care procedures can further extend the system’s life and maintain optimal appearance throughout its service life.
Regular visual inspection represents the most important maintenance activity for silicone render installations. Property owners should periodically examine the render surface for any signs of damage, staining, or deterioration that might require attention. While silicone render demonstrates excellent durability, mechanical damage from impacts or severe weather events can occasionally occur. Early identification and repair of any damage prevents water penetration and maintains the system’s protective integrity.
Professional maintenance services can address specific issues that may arise over time, such as localised staining or minor damage repair. The compatibility of repair materials with existing silicone render systems requires expertise to ensure seamless integration and continued performance. Regular maintenance schedules can be developed for commercial properties or extensive residential installations where systematic care provides long-term cost benefits.
